    Principal Rail Capital Financial Analyst

    Summary :

    The Principal Rail Capital Finance Analyst plays a key role in helping coordinate project scoping details, selections, and the prioritization of a Rail Operations’ capital investments that enhance safety, reliability, and capacity across the rail system. This position also works with budgeting, procurement, and contract administration to support internal company processes while ensuring compliance with regulatory and funding requirements. Monitors project performance to help ensure efficient, on-schedule delivery and effective use of financial resources. Working closely with operations, engineering, and capital delivery teams, this role helps ensure that capital investments are aligned with Rail Operations’ needs and strategic priorities. As part of a team committed to delivering capital projects that provide long-term value, this position supports NJ TRANSIT’s mission to build a modern and reliable rail network that meets the region’s future transportation demands.

    Roles and Responsibilities :

    •Prepares, develops, implements, and monitors Rail Operations capital budgets to ensure that spending limits are met.

    •Coordinates the review, submission, and approval of capital project budgets, requisitions, change orders, and funding realignments for Rail capital projects.

    •Ensures the accuracy of data charged to funded Rail programs through payroll, inventory, purchase orders, and direct financial entries; initiates corrective action when necessary to validate data integrity.

    •Provides quantitative and qualitative analysis using measures such as trend analysis, ratios, extrapolation, percentages, inflation, and other performance indicators to support Rail’s capital programs and budgets.

    •Provides Rail-related capital project data for the preparation of reports for federal compliance.

    •Works collaboratively with other NJ TRANSIT departments to align project funding and financial controls with strategic priorities and ensure efficient project delivery.

    •Supports long-term capital project planning and prioritization efforts by integrating fiscal analysis into project development and scoping activities.

    Education, Experience and Qualifications / Knowledge & Skills Required :

    •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Business Administration, related area or equivalent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Business Administration, Transportation Planning, Economics, Public Policy/Administration or a related field.

    •Minimum of three (3) years’ experience in the development, preparation, implementation, or financial controls of transportation projects.

    •Master’s Degree or professional certification(s) in a relevant field may be counted for up to one (1) year of required experience.

    Knowledge and Skills :

    •Experience working with financial management systems and capital reporting tools.

    •Demonstrated experience with financial reporting and analysis.

    •Proficiency in Microsoft Office products including, Excel, Word, Outlook, Teams and Access required, strong PC skills essential.

    •Excellent verbal and written communication skills with the ability to present complex financial data clearly and persuasively

    Working Environment :

    • Work environment: Primarily office-based with site visits (including field inspections at stations, yards, and facilities).
